Adjuster

PRIMARY PURPOSE: To handle losses and claims for property and casualty insurers.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S and RESPONSIBILITIES
- Examines insurance policies and other records to determine insurance coverage.
- Interviews, telephones, and/or corresponds with claimant and witnesses regarding claim.
- Consults police and hospital records and inspects property damage to determine extent of company's liability and varying methods of investigation according to type of insurance.
- Estimates cost of repair, replacement, or compensation.
- Prepares report of findings and negotiates settlement with claimant.
- Recommends litigation by legal department when settlement cannot be negotiated.
- Attends litigation hearings.
- Revises case reserves in assigned claims files to cover probable costs.
- Assists in preparing loss experience report to help determine profitability and calculates adequate future rates.
